Key responsibilities


To deliver continued sales growth, build AOV and to improve add to basket through B&Q and Trade-point ecommerce platforms for a specific category.


  • Identify opportunities for increasing revenue using web analytics tools to improve key performance metrics such as conversion, bounce rate, AOV and page views
  • Implement our SEO strategy to drive quality, relevant traffic, ensuring "Best in class" customer & search engine experience.
  • Support the various customers shopping missions, including how devices influence the customer and championing the online customer experience with a view to improving conversion & customer satisfaction.
  • Influence the Trading Teams to drive a strong promotional plan and online range extensions.
  • Take ownership of onsite category merchandising, driving cross/upsell to increase AOV, with responsibility to analyse impact and optimise
  • Review performance of merchandising and making iterative improvements to maximise sales.
  • Liaise across the E-Commerce and trading team to ensure that any relevant marketing activity (publications and promotions) are supported on the website
  • Successfully manage the automated product recommendation tool and onsite search tool to increase average order values.
  • Manage the removal and additions of products for owned categories.
